section.u4m-g2-badges .container{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;float:none;margin:0 auto;max-width:1400rem;padding:20rem;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}section.u4m-g2-badges .heading{font-size:50rem;font-weight:800;letter-spacing:.25rem;line-height:1.2;margin-bottom:40rem;text-align:center;width:100%}section.u4m-g2-badges .badges{align-items:center;display:flex;gap:20px;justify-content:center}section.u4m-g2-badges .badges .first-badge{display:flex;gap:20rem}section.u4m-g2-badges .badges .badge-bg{background:linear-gradient(224deg,rgba(38,208,116,.2),rgba(0,135,183,.2));border-radius:20px;flex-shrink:0;padding:10px 20px;width:185px}section.u4m-g2-badges .badges .badge-bg img{opacity:.8}section.u4m-g2-badges .badges .right-badges{align-items:center;display:flex;gap:20px;justify-content:center}section.u4m-g2-badges .badges .badge{cursor:pointer;max-width:100px;opacity:.8;transform:translateY(0);transition:transform .15s ease-in-out}section.u4m-g2-badges .divider{border-right:2px dashed #606060;display:flex;flex-direction:row;opacity:.5;width:10px}section.u4m-g2-badges .cta-wrapper{display:flex;justify-content:center;margin-top:40rem;width:100%}section.u4m-g2-badges .cta-wrapper a{margin:0}@media screen and (max-width:1024px){section.u4m-g2-badges .heading{font-size:45rem}}@media screen and (max-width:600px){section.u4m-g2-badges .badges{align-items:center;display:flex;flex-flow:wrap;justify-content:center}section.u4m-g2-badges .badges .right-badges{flex-wrap:wrap}section.u4m-g2-badges .divider{display:none}section.u4m-g2-badges .first-badge{display:flex;justify-content:center;width:100%}}